#e2fea2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e2fea2 is composed of 88.6% red, 99.6% green and 63.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.2%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 78.3 degrees, a saturation of 97.9% and a lightness of 81.6%. #e2fea2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c5fd45. Closest websafe color is: #ccff99.

Shades and Tints of #e2fea2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030400 is the darkest color, while #fafff0 is the lightest one.
